
Join us for the launch of The Oxford Handbook of Peaceful Assembly, a pioneering new volume on protest and the right of peaceful assembly.
The Oxford Handbook of Peaceful Assembly examines assembly as a distinct political and social practice that sits uneasily at the heart of the modern state, at times posing a threat to the political status quo. It brings together a multidisciplinary group of experts—lawyers, political theorists, sociologists, anthropologists, and historians—to offer a critical, international overview of the field.
